While many families celebrate the arrival of bundles of joy into the world, for others, it is not so much of a delightful moment.

This is because the new mothers are teenagers, a lot of whom have been impregnated by adults.

This thorny subject is forever present, and it has once again been highlighted by the recent delivery of Christmas babies.

According to the Department of Health, this year (2025), 1668 babies were delivered on Wednesday, three of them belonged to teenage mothers, including a 15-year-old.
